Apache BCEL Source Code Files
Apache BCEL Source Code Files are inside the Apache BCEL source package file
like bcel-6.6.1-src.zip.
Unzip the source package file and go to the "src/main" sub-directory,
you will see source code files.

package org.apache.bcel.generic;
/**
* Denotes that an instruction may start the process of loading and resolving the referenced class in the Virtual
* Machine.
*/
public interface LoadClass {
/**
* Returns the ObjectType of the referenced class or interface that may be loaded and resolved.
*
* @return object type that may be loaded or null if a primitive is referenced
*/
ObjectType getLoadClassType(ConstantPoolGen cpg);
/**
* Returns the type associated with this instruction. LoadClass instances are always typed, but this type does not
* always refer to the type of the class or interface that it possibly forces to load. For example, GETFIELD would
* return the type of the field and not the type of the class where the field is defined. If no class is forced to be
* loaded, <B>null</B> is returned. An example for this is an ANEWARRAY instruction that creates an int[][].
*
* @see #getLoadClassType(ConstantPoolGen)
*/
Type getType(ConstantPoolGen cpg);
}
